Abstract
This chapter journeys through creative homologation contributions made in accessing oxiranes and aziridines from carbonyl and imine platforms beginning in the late 1800s to present times. Significant emphasis was placed on Darzens [2+1]-inspired annulations, with selected contributions in ylide and diazo chemistry following in later sections. Mechanistic analysis of selected strategies as well as applications to total synthesis are described.
